11:48 — Payment retries on Ledgerlane started double-charging because the idempotency key included a timestamp (yes, really), so every retry minted a fresh key. Gateway happily processed duplicates. Priya caught it from the refund spike, hotfixed the key to order-scoped only, and backfilled dedupe checks. Duplicates stopped by 12:15; refunds automated. Please review the key derivation carefully. The fix shipped in the build noted below.

trace token, fafog-kageg: htk4_98e6

Alert: SDK parity drift detected between Brightmoor's Kestrel-JS and Kestrel-Swift clients. The nightly parity suite found three methods present in JS but absent or differently typed in Swift, which usually means a spec change merged without the cross-SDK checklist. Reviewers should block merges touching the shared spec until parity is restored. The full diff, affected methods, and the parity checklist are on the page below.

runbook for badug-kadup: https://confluence.zemvarlabs.internal/projects/browse/display/projects/bd1b

## Off-site Run — Halbrook Film Archive

- Collect 14 reels from Studio Merrow vault, cage 3.
- Reels stay flat, never upright; use the padded crates from bay two.
- Driver confirms crate count against the manifest before departure.
- No stops between Merrow and the Halbrook receiving dock.
- Climate van only — reels degrade fast in heat.
- Archive staff sign the transfer slip on arrival.
- Give the driver the following hand-over instruction verbally before the run.

courier memo of kahap-faweg: the kasok eliiel courier leaves the noveth gilael weniel ledger at gate 9433 under passcode 012665